  Sometimes there just doesn’t seem to be enough of me to go around. Right from the day when I heard those fateful words, “Definitely two babies,” I knew that there would be tough times to come. Times when I just couldn’t give both children what they needed right when they needed it. Of course, since then I’ve doubled that problem, and now I am stretching my resources between four small people. Sometimes I have reinforcements, but often it is just me and them.  Read more >

The nickname "idiot box" well describes how I feel TV and kids generally get along. You plonk a child in front of the TV and all you’ll get is a stagnant, vacant, dumbed down version of what was once an active, bright, spunky, individual. There are so many other, better, things kids could be doing. For a long time I’ve held the view that TV is not great for kids. I still hold that view, but lately I’ve been reassessing how TV works in our family.  Read more >

I'm Kate.

I blog at picklebums.com

I'm married and we have four 'picklebums'  - Zoe and Izzy (who are 7 and ID twins), Muski (who is three and no that is not his real name!) and Quatro (who is 6 months old - also not his real name!)  We live on ten acres of weeds that we jokingly call The Pickle Farm,  in ‘almost rural’ Victoria, Australia.

Before I had kids I was a preschool teacher. Now I stay home and dabble in a bit of gardening, raising chickens and ducks, trying to be a little bit self suffcient  and being a Mum. I also do a little bit of digital scrapbooking, digital design and blog design. I blog about all that as well activities for children, parenting, a few recipes and all the rest of the craziness that is our life.

We are attempting to grow our family with love and gentleness, while playing at our own version of being a little bit self sufficient and environmentally aware. Among the weeds we are growing veggies, fruit, native plants, chooks and children, learning a lot along the way and generally enjoying life.
